Senior Developer

Chief Financial Accountant
Location: Amatitlán
Commercial Advisor
Financial Analyst
Home Collection Manager
Credit Analyst
Automotive Mechanic Type A
Automotive Type A Full Time, Guatemala City
Senior Developer

Senior Developer

Job Description

We are looking for a Senior Full-Stack Developer to join our dynamic and growing team. The ideal candidate will be responsible for full web and mobile application development, from frontend design to backend implementation and database management.

Benefits

  • Hybrid mode.
  • Compensation according to experience, knowledge and studies.
  • A dynamic and collaborative work environment.
  • Opportunities for professional growth and continuous development.
  • Challenging and technologically advanced projects.

Requirements

WE REQUIRE: Male/female gender

  • University degree in Systems Engineering, Computer Science or related field, or equivalent experience.
  • Minimum 5 years of software development experience, with a focus on web and mobile applications.
  • Solid experience in Node.js, Angular, TypeScript and Flutter.
  • Advanced knowledge of databases such as MongoDB, PostgreSQL and MariaDB.
  • Experience in developing RESTful APIs.
  • Familiarity with the use of version control systems, especially Git.
  • Experience implementing and managing cloud solutions, preferably on Google Cloud Platform.
  • Solid knowledge of unit and integration testing.
Desirable:

  • Experience in Docker and Kubernetes for container orchestration.
  • Knowledge in CI/CD (Continuous Integration/Continuous Deployment) using tools such as Jenkins, GitLab CI/CD or similar.
  • Familiarity with agile software development practices, such as Scrum or Kanban.
  • Experience with additional frontend technologies such as React or Vue.js.
  • Knowledge of web security and best practices for securing web and mobile applications.
  • Experience in serverless application development.

Personal Data

Languages:
To have your information in our job board or future applications, indicate your area of ​​interest (maximum 3)